Looking for some free PC games that will help you learn something? Good news – Ubisoft is giving you that chance. The educational Discovery Tour modes for both Assassin’s Creed Odyssey and Assassin’s Creed Origins are now free to keep through the publisher’s Uplay store. The promotions only last for a limited time, so hop to it.

You can head to the Ubisoft giveaways page to claim both Discovery Tour: Ancient Greece and Discovery Tour: Ancient Egypt from now until May 21 at 11:00 EDT / 14:00 EDT / 19:00 BST. Once you’ve claimed the games, they will remain in your library forever, so you can partake in the history lessons whenever you want.

Both these Discovery Tours are standalone releases, so you don’t need to own Odyssey or Origins to play them. (Owners of the original games already have access to the Discovery Tours as an in-game mode.) Both educational modes use the world of their respective games to present a variety of tours through the historical setting, without the pressure of combat or quests to get in the way.
